Ethernet switches reduce engineering effort
Jetnet 3505/3508 industrial Ethernet switches are designed for the applications that require network redundancy but easy maintenance.
Korenix Jetnet 3505/3508 industrial Ethernet switches are designed for the applications that require network redundancy but easy maintenance.
In the network environment, ring redundancy is a very important technology to make sure the data transmission will not be interrupted by link failures, and Korenix Super Ring is an impressive solution with less than 300us recovery time.
The JetNet 3500 Series industrial unmanaged redundant Ethernet rail switch is an ideal way to implement this technology with minimal engineering effort.
The JetNet 3500 supports plug-and-play Super Ring for the self-healing network redundancy.
Just switch the Ring Master DIP, and the master of the ring is set.
The redundant ring's backup path is also defined.
JetNet 3500 also provides an alarm relay output function that will automatically form an open circuit when power fails or port link breaks.
The built-in relay contact can be used to set up a warning system to alert a maintenance engineer in the shortest possible time.
